The original price was $225 and the price after the discount was $180, what was the discount percent

The discount percent is 20% off because you would subtract the discount from the original price and get 45. 45 is 20% of 225.

To find the answer, you have to make a proportion. 
Percent of discount = discount / regular price 
d = 45 / 225 
d =0.2
So to covert 0.2 to a percent, move the decimal point 2 places to the right.
= 20%
( By the way, 45 is $225 - $180)
To check it, I'm gonna multiply $225 * 0.20 = 45
And then subtract 225 - 45 = 180 
So the discount percent is 20%
